Men's Golf Team Improves on Day Two
5/18/2001 12:00:00 AM | Men's Golf
May 18, 2001
STILLWATER, Okla.--The TCU Horned Frogs recorded a 15-over-par 303 during Friday's second round of the NCAA Central Regional in Stillwater, Oklahoma. With the effort, the Frogs moved closer to the tournament's lead pack, but remain in 26th place. TCU must finish in the top 10 at the three-day event to advance to the NCAA Championships for the ninth time in the last 11 years.
While the team may be considered a longshot to make the tournament, TCU sophomore Adam Rubinson has a chance to qualify individually. After two rounds, the Fort Worth native is at even-par (144) and sits in a tie for 11th place. The top two individuals on non-advancing teams qualify to play in the NCAAs.
Senior Aaron Hickman moved into a tie for 79th after shooting a two-over-par 74 on Friday. TCU's other competitors include: senior Scott Volpitto (T107th-157), freshman Stephen Polanski (T120th-159) and junior Andy Doeden (T127th-161).
The College of Charleston leads the field by six strokes with a two-day score of 578. Play concludes on Saturday with the final 18 holes. Scoring updates are available periodically throughout each day on www.golfstat.com and on www.okstate.com.
The NCAA Division I Men's Championship, hosted by Duke, is scheduled for May 30-June2 at the Duke University Golf Course in Durham, N.C.
